ADULT AUTISM ASSESSMENT
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) is a neurodevelopmental difference that can present in many ways. While it has historically been diagnosed in childhood, many individuals go undiagnosed until adulthood. This can happen for a number of reasons—early traits may have been misunderstood, masked, or attributed to other conditions. As a result, many adults seeking support today describe feeling chronically misunderstood, underserved by past therapy, or unsure why certain areas of life remain persistently difficult.
In recent years, our understanding of autism has grown. Clinicians now recognize that autism can show up in more subtle or internalized ways—especially in adults, women, and individuals who have spent years camouflaging their differences. Common experiences may include sensory sensitivities, social burnout, difficulties with unstructured time, or feeling overwhelmed by changes in routine or expectations.
A comprehensive adult autism assessment can help bring clarity to these experiences. It involves a careful, multi-step process that looks at developmental history, lived experiences, and current functioning across several domains. Importantly, it’s not just about diagnosis—it’s about gaining insight, understanding your unique profile, and finding language for needs that may have gone unnamed for years.
Getting assessed as an adult can be a powerful turning point. Many individuals find it validating, even life-changing. It can open the door to new self-understanding, connect you with supportive communities, and provide access to accommodations that help you work, relate, and live in a way that feels more aligned and resourced.
